Core Concepts Exam 4
5 factors affecting skin integrity
- genetics & heredity
- age
- chronic illness & treatment
- medications
- poor nutrition


3 risk assessment tools for pressure ulcers
- Braden scale
- Norton scale
- Waterlow scale


Anything less than ___ on the Braden scale is a high risk for a pressure injury
18


Anything greater than ___ on the Braden scale is a low risk for a pressure injury
19


The Braden scale has a possibility of ___ possible points
23


Nonblanchable erythema signaling potential ulceration
Stage I


Partial-thickness skin loss involving epidermis and possibly dermis
Stage II


Full-thickness skin loss involving damage or necrosis of subcutaneous tissue
Stage III


Full-thickness skin loss with tissue necrosis or damage to muscle, bone, or supporting structures
Stage IV


3 types of wound healing
- primary
- secondary
- tertiary


___ healing occurs when there's little to no tissue loss
primary


___ healing occurs when there is a loss of tissue; longer healing time
secondary

, ___ healing occurs when there's a deep open wound left open to close later
tertiary


3 phases of wound healing
- inflammatory
- proliferative
- maturation


4 types of wound exudate
- serous
- purulent
- sanguinous
- mixed


Clear fluid
serous


Mixture of clear & blood (pink)
serosanguinous


Bright red blood
sanguinous


Yellow, thick drainage
purulent


___ exudate is indicative of infection
purulent


4 complications of wound healing
- hemorrhage
- infection
- dehiscence
- evisceration


___ open wounds are healthy regeneration of tissue; must protect
red


___ open wounds indicate the presence of purulent drainage and slough; must cleanse
yellow


___ open wounds indicate the presence of eschar that hinders healing and requires removal; must
debride
black
